Package org.opennms.netmgt.icmp.jna
Class JnaPingRequestId
- java.lang.Object
-
- org.opennms.netmgt.icmp.jna.JnaPingRequestId
-
public class JnaPingRequestId extends java.lang.Object
JnaPingRequestId class.
- Version:
- $Id: $
- Author:
- ranger
-
-
Constructor Summary
Constructors Constructor Description JnaPingRequestId(java.net.InetAddress addr, int identifier, int sequenceNumber, long threadId)
Constructor for JnaPingRequestId.JnaPingRequestId(JnaPingReply reply)
Constructor for JnaPingRequestId.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(java.lang.Object obj)
java.net.InetAddress
getAddress()
getAddressint
getIdentifier()
getTidint
getSequenceNumber()
getSequenceIdlong
getThreadId()
int
hashCode()
java.lang.String
toString()
toString
-
-
-
Constructor Detail
-
JnaPingRequestId
public JnaPingRequestId(java.net.InetAddress addr, int identifier, int sequenceNumber, long threadId)
Constructor for JnaPingRequestId.
- Parameters:
addr
- aInetAddress
object.identifier
- a long.seqId
- a short.
-
JnaPingRequestId
public JnaPingRequestId(JnaPingReply reply)
Constructor for JnaPingRequestId.
- Parameters:
reply
- aorg.opennms.netmgt.icmp.spi.JnaPingReply.PingReply
object.
-
-
Method Detail
-
getAddress
public java.net.InetAddress getAddress()
getAddress
- Returns:
- a
InetAddress
object.
-
getIdentifier
public int getIdentifier()
getTid
- Returns:
- a long.
-
getSequenceNumber
public int getSequenceNumber()
getSequenceId
- Returns:
- a short.
-
getThreadId
public long getThreadId()
-
equals
public boolean equals(java.lang.Object obj)
- Overrides:
equals
in class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()
toString
- Overrides:
toString
in classjava.lang.Object
- Returns:
- a
String
object.
-
-